Common Types of Concrete Testing

The testing of concrete can be carried out at various stages of construction through a number of standardized tests. 

Compressive Strength Testing

One of the most frequently used tests is the compressive strength test of concrete cylinders after curing. This verifies that the concrete has attained the specified design strength prior to carrying structural loads. 

Slump Testing

Slump test measures the consistency of fresh concrete and gives an indication of the workability. A good slump guarantees that the concrete can be placed and consolidated easily without sacrificing the strength. 

Air Content Testing

Air-entrained concrete is produced by the intentional incorporation of tiny air bubbles into the mix, which increases its resistance to certain environmental conditions. Testing the air content confirms that the concrete mix has the right amount of entrained air. 

Temperature Monitoring

The temperature of fresh concrete has a profound influence on the rate of curing and strength development. Technicians keep track of the temperatures during placement to confirm that they meet the requirements of the project specifications. 

Unit Weight Testing

Unit weight testing provides a measure of the density and yield of fresh concrete and serves as a check that the correct proportions of the mix have been used. 

Core Sampling

When doubts about existing concrete structures arise, technicians drill cylindrical cores for laboratory testing. Core tests are used to assess the in-place strength and possible defects.

Advanced Concrete Testing Methods

Contemporary testing firms utilize state of the art equipment and technology to enhance the accuracy and efficiency. 

Some specialized testing methods include:

  • Non-destructive testing (NDT)

  • Ultrasonic pulse velocity testing

  • Rebound hammer testing

  • Ground penetrating radar (GPR)

  • Concrete maturity testing

  • Chloride content testing

  • Permeability testing

  • Petrographic analysis

These techniques give the engineers an opportunity to assess the concrete without the need to take destructive samples from finished structures.
